WebDuring the Jurassic Era, sharks began to evolve flexible and protruding jaws so they could attack and eat larger prey. They also developed tail fins that allowed them to swim faster and more efficiently. Most sharks also developed mouths under their snout. Web28 feb. 2024 · Like many animals in the ocean, sharks are also camouflaged. Sharks are darker on top, so when an animal looks down at a shark, the shark blends into the dark ocean depths. How have great white sharks adapted to their environment? Adaptations. Shark bodies have a torpedo shape to reduce drag in the water.

A hammerhead shark is a fish.Its average size is 13 feet long to 20 feet long [4 to 6 meters].The average weight is 500 to 1000 pounds [230 to 450 kilograms].it is also … A shark has a heart that has two chambers. This heart is strong and muscular, and it is why it can sustain the shark’s need for blood during a hunt. Contrary to popular belief, a shark does not have two hearts. Web30 jun. 2016 · Here’s how it works: without big sharks preying on them, populations of smaller sharks and big fish called “mesopredators,” would increase. The greater number of mesopredators would then consume more herbivorous fish, which feed on algae. Web14 apr. 2024 · Both sharks and cheetahs are adapted to be good predators. Sharks have streamlined bodies, powerful jaws, and sharp teeth that allow them to swim quickly and catch prey such as fish, seals, and even other sharks. They also have electroreceptors that can detect the electrical signals produced by the muscles of prey animals. Web19 okt. 2024 · Physical Adaptations. The body shape of the great white is one of its main adaptations, being much like a torpedo so as to limit friction while swimming. The powerful tail and muscular body help the large fish to swim at up to 15 mph. Sheer size is an adaptation in itself. The shark reaches lengths of up to 20 feet and weighs as much as …
